December 21, 2010 - In spite of the current economy and the housing crisis which is currently affecting thousands of homeowners across the country,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) backed home loans have a much smaller foreclosure rate. However, veterans are being affected by stricter lending environments, which have made the VA-backed loans harder to obtain.
The last 2 years have seen many soldiers denied for VA home loans due to more stringent lending standards. This means not only are fewer soldiers purchasing homes, fewer soldiers are able to refinance. One of the most attractive features of VA home loans is the "no down payment" feature. Although that is still a very much available option, without a credit score of 610 or higher, soldiers are still running into financing issues.
Very likely gone forever are the days of soldiers being able to get refinancing loans to lower interest rates without credit checks or appraisals. That is not to say the VA Loan Guaranty program is suffering, however. In fact, the program is still very strong and qualified borrowers can still get lower rates and more security in their loan than through a traditional bank loan.
Stricter lending did result in fewer VA loans being awarded, but that will hopefully change in the near future. Most likely, credit restrictions will continue to stay in place as opposed to slipping back to where they were before the sub-prime meltdown. It is on the soldier to make sure they make an attractive borrower so they can qualify for the VA-backed loan they have earned.
